Added User List table

This commit is contained in:
2026-01-20 22:21:06 +07:00
parent 1423d8af53
commit e02564b5cd
45 changed files with 1866 additions and 292 deletions

View File

@@ -2,6 +2,7 @@ import { m } from '@/paraglide/messages';
import { settingQueries } from '@/service/queries';
import { updateAdminSettings } from '@/service/setting.api';
import { settingSchema, SettingsInput } from '@/service/setting.schema';
import { ReturnError } from '@/types/common';
import { GearIcon } from '@phosphor-icons/react';
import { useForm } from '@tanstack/react-form';
import { useMutation, useQuery, useQueryClient } from '@tanstack/react-query';
@@ -32,6 +33,13 @@ const SettingsForm = () => {
richColors: true,
});
},
onError: (error: ReturnError) => {
console.error(error);
toast.error(
(m[`backend_${error.code}` as keyof typeof m] as () => string)(),
{ richColors: true },
);
},
});
const form = useForm({